Formula
tbsp = µL × 6.76280454037 × 10-5
µL = tbsp ÷ 6.76280454037 × 10-5
Conversion table
| 1 µL | 6.7628 × 10-5 tbsp |
| 5 µL | 0.00033814 tbsp |
| 10 µL | 0.00067628 tbsp |
| 20 µL | 0.00135256 tbsp |
| 50 µL | 0.0033814 tbsp |
| 100 µL | 0.0067628 tbsp |
| 500 µL | 0.033814 tbsp |
| 1000 µL | 0.067628 tbsp |

About this conversion
The Microliter and the Tablespoon are both units of volume. The microliter is a metric volume unit equal to 10-6 liters, representing an extremely small quantity used mainly in scientific and theoretical contexts. The US tablespoon is a common cooking measurement equal to three teaspoons, used for liquid and dry ingredients in recipes. To convert, multiply the Microliters value by 6.76280454037 × 10-5 (formula: tbsp = µL × 6.76280454037 × 10-5).
